FMF Study Group

In the study group consisting of children with FMF, DMFT, dft, bruxism, tooth wear due to bruxism, gingival index (MGI), plaque index (OHI-S), salivary pH, salivary flow rate, salivary buffering capacity, dental age, chronological age difference, mesio-distal dimensions of the teeth, and the presence of aphthous lesions were determined.

OTHER

control group

In the control group consisting of healthy children, DMFT, dft, bruxism, tooth wear due to bruxism, gingival index (MGI), plaque index (OHI-S), salivary pH, salivary flow rate, salivary buffering capacity, dental age, chronological age difference, mesio-distal dimensions of the teeth, and the presence of aphthous lesions were determined.
